Comparison Study in the Treatment of Uterine Fibroids Uterine Fibroid Embolization Using BeadBlock™ Embolic Agent

A double arm (non-inferiority) 44 patient study to assess the performance of BeadBlock™ in the treatment of uterine fibroids by embolization with respect to clinical & imaging outcome with comparison of primary safety endpoints to Embosphere.

About this study

The purpose of the study is to conduct a comparison between BeadBlock™ and Embosphere in uterine fibroid embolization. Baseline and follow-up MR Imaging data will be made with respect to changes in fibroid and uterus perfusion and fibroid and uterine volume. This is a 12 months study (12 month follow up for all enrollees). The primary end-point will be the degree of fibroid devascularization as seen at contrast-enhanced MRI performed 3 months (+/- 15 days) after UAE procedure. In addition we will assess symptom reduction in patients that have undergone uterine fibroid embolization with Bead Block™ and Embosphere®.

Primary Objective 1. To assess the change in fibroid devascularization as seen at contrast-enhanced MRI performed after UAE and at three (3) months (+/- 15 days) following the UAE, and compare the changes between BeadBlock™ and Embosphere.

Secondary Objective

  • To assess the change in fibroid devascularization as seen at contrast-enhanced MRI performed several days after UAE and 6 months (+/- 15 days) following the UAE, and compare the changes between BeadBlock™ and Embosphere.

Tertiary Objective

  • To assess the change in uterine volume as seen at contrast-enhanced MRI performed several days after UAE, 3 months (+/- 15 days) and 6 months (+/- 15 days) following the UAE, and compare the changes between BeadBlock™ and Embosphere.
  • To assess the change from baseline in symptom severity (UFS-QOL)at 3, 6 and 12 months (+/- 15 days) follow-up, as measured by the subscale of the UFS questionnaire, and compare the changes between BeadBlock™ and Embosphere.

Inclusion criteria

  • Patient chooses to participate and has signed informed consent
  • Age between 30 and 50 years old
  • Symptoms caused by uterine fibroids, such as heavy bleeding (menorrhagia) and/or bulk-related complaints such as urinary frequency, constipation or pelvic pain.
  • Patient has fibroids confirmed by MRI
  • Patient has normal kidney function.
  • Patient is willing and able to undergo follow-up imaging at 3 and 6 months post UFE.

Exclusion criteria

  • Patients who are pregnant or plan to become pregnant within the study period, or desire future fertility.
  • Patients with a history of gynecologic malignancy
  • Patients with known endometrial hyperplasia
  • Patients with adenomyosis
  • Patients with pelvic inflammatory disease
  • Patients with Uteri < 250 ml (cm) calculated volume or > 24 weeks
  • Patients with pedunculated subserosal fibroids with a narrow attachment (<50% diameter of the fibroid) to the uterus.
  • Patients with pelvic pain as dominant syndrome
  • Known allergy to contrast media that cannot be adequately pre-medicated.
  • Patients not suitable for arterial access.
  • Previous uterine artery embolization attempts.
  • History of pelvic irradiation.
  • Patients on GnRH Therapy within 3-6 months prior to the study enrollment.
